Responsible for receipt of goods from suppliers, and delivery of raw materials, purchased parts and supplies throughout the company using various power equipment, manual equipment, and by hand .
Duties and Responsibilities:
Opens boxes, crates, and performs visual inspection of received goods
Unloads skids of materials from trucks using hand power lifts or fork truck
Reports any visibly damaged materials to management. Prepares basic documentation of damaged materials including pictures
Counts or weighs goods to ensure quantity/weights match receiving paperwork
Data enters received goods into company database (MFG Pro)
Initials and stamps receiving paperwork with date, initials and forwards to office
Delivers goods to appropriate department or location by hand or by use of motorized hand trucks or fork truck
Works as part of the team and assists within other areas of the department or company when needed
Works in a safe manner, utilizing all required personal protective equipment
All other duties as assigned by Manager
Qualifications:
Shipping/receiving experience helpful
Excellent organization skills
Basic mathematical aptitude
Prior experience operating various manufacturing lifting equipment including hand jacks and fork truck
Physical Demands:
Must be able to become fork truck certified and able to operate, mount, and dismount fork truck safely.
Must be able to lift approximately 50 lbs and carry approximately 30 lbs. Specific vision requirements include close vision. Must be able to use hands to handle and carry. Must regularly stand throughout workday, bend, reach and lift.
